How can teams contribute to CQI efforts?

Teams play a vital role in Continuous Quality Improvement (CQI) efforts by collaborating to identify problems, analyze data, and develop improvement strategies. This collaborative approach allows individuals with diverse perspectives and expertise to come together, fostering a comprehensive understanding of the challenges faced by an organization.

Through teamwork, members can share insights and experiences that enhance problem identification, ensuring that various facets of a situation are considered. Analyzing data together enables teams to uncover patterns and trends that might not be visible when working in isolation. This collective analysis leads to more informed decision-making and the co-creation of effective improvement strategies that are more likely to be implemented successfully and accepted across the organization.

Moreover, collaboration encourages open communication and collective ownership of both the challenges and solutions, thereby increasing the commitment of team members to the CQI process. It's this synergy that significantly drives organizational improvement, creating sustainable results over time.
